Summer is here, and so is the unbearable heat. If you're lucky enough to have an air conditioning unit, now is the time to give it some love and attention. Your AC is your best friend during these scorching months, and you don't want it to let you down when you need it the most. So, let's shine up your AC and beat the heat! ## Got AC? Here's how to make it shine! First things first, let's start with the exterior. Your AC is exposed to dust, dirt, and all sorts of debris, so it's bound to get dirty. That's why it's important to clean it regularly. Start by wiping the outside of the unit with a damp cloth. If you see any rust, use a wire brush to scrub it off. Don't forget to remove any leaves or branches that might be stuck in the fins. Now, let's move onto the interior. The most critical part of your AC is the air filter. A dirty air filter not only affects the efficiency of your unit but also the quality of the air you breathe. It's recommended to replace or clean the filter every two to three months. If you have pets or allergies, you might want to do it more often. Check your owner's manual for instructions on how to access and replace the filter. Lastly, if you want to go the extra mile, you can give your AC a tune-up. Hire a professional technician to inspect your unit, clean the coils, check the refrigerant levels, and make sure everything is in working order. You'll save money in the long run by preventing costly repairs and prolonging the life of your AC. ## Don't let the heat get to you - clean your AC! If you neglect your AC, it will neglect you. A dirty unit will struggle to keep up with demand, resulting in higher energy bills and less comfort. Plus, a poorly maintained AC can lead to health problems such as allergies, respiratory issues, and even carbon monoxide poisoning. Cleaning your AC is not only about appearance but also about functionality and safety. So, don't wait until it's too late. Take care of your AC, and it will take care of you. We are Kathrin and Daniel. We sail, cruise and live aboard our sailing yacht SV Polaris Helvetica, a Bavaria Cruiser 46 since spriung 2021. We left our native Switzerland and moved to the UK almost two decades ago. In 2021, in our mid 50-ies, after our three boys left the nest we made a big decision. We left the rat race in London behind and made our beloved Polaris our primary floating home. Over the years we have added many upgrades to Polaris. We got rid of the standard propane gas cooker and replaced it with an electric cooker and oven. We fitted a generator and changed to a lithium (LiFePo) house battery bank. We added a 1'200W solar arch and a water maker. We added an inner forestay for a working jib and a storm sail. With all these upgrades Polaris is now a comfortable live aboard yacht. We sail her along Scotland's beautiful coastline and we live on her summer and winter. Kathrin loves cooking and baking on board. You will see some of her cookery wonders across our episodes. The WS500 Wakespeed alternator regulator utilizes current, voltage and temperature when charging 12V, 24V or 48V LiFePO4 lithium-ion battery systems. In this maintenance blog I retro fit this sophisticated regulator to our battery bank in the last of this lithium battery instal video series. I have had to replace the heating element a couple of times on my boat. It is an easy job and you should schedule this into your maintenance plan. The video is unfortunately not comprehensive but I thought I would post it to help anyone who is going through the process. It is an easy job so crack on and just do it. If you are removing the whole tank to clean it out, you will also need to disconnect the coolant pipes. This is a bit more challenging and you will need to refer to your engine owners manual too. When you have coolant loss in the system, you can end up with air-pockets in the pipework and these can be difficult to remove. Make sure you buy the right element for either 110V or 220V. When replacing the element, take care to not over tighten it as you can damage the rubber seal. I suggest ordering a couple of spare seals / o-rings as backup.

A truly exceptional example of this well-regarded, capable and sought-after Briand-designed fast cruiser. In ownership of the same family since new and lovingly maintained by a shore-based Captain who is an expert in the Bordeaux 60. Recommended without hesitation. NOTABLE FEATURES • Unusually low usage for such a capable yacht, she has not left the Med since delivery, her log shows less than 12,000 nautical miles, 1500 engine hours run and just over 1000 generator hours usage all of which is documented • Tremendous attention to detail throughout by a truly fastidious owner • Truly remarkable condition, outstanding maintenance • Electric all-furling rig – no need to leave the cockpit • Centre-line owners’ berth is spacious and has access from both sides • A unique and custom-built interior based on the 100 foot CNB “CHRISCO” • Full air conditioning and majority of factory options were chosen • Detailed log showing history from delivery in 2011 • Upgraded 2,45 metre lead keel • High spec and inventory including teak on the coachroof and grey caulking • Excellent sail wardrobe • Extensive general inventory included • Good RIB with well-arranged stowage and handling To see all our listings: www.aberyyachts.com

Episode 031 Deep Water Cove – we guess the clue is in the name! No kidding, it is deep and what does Adam do…well goes snorkeling of course! We are in awe of this place. We have sailed to this place a couple of times over summer and each time we’ve seen something special. The first time we had dolphins visit us for over 2 hours as they hunted for food and put on a display. The second time, we were visited by a manta ray who swam around for a few hours. Deep Water Cove is the last anchorage before Cape Brett on the Bay of Islands side and is open to the ocean so it’s no surprise the treasures of the ocean visit here. It’s also a place where you can do the walk to the Cape Brett lighthouse (which we attempted but alas it was too hard!). Alongside its natural beauty, what makes this place even more special is the rāhui (prohibition) that was placed in 2010 (and continues today) due to depleting fish stocks so you can’t fish or take any aquatic life or seaweed from this anchorage. The result of this rāhui speaks for itself as you will see during Adam’s snorkeling adventure and what can be achieved when we allow regeneration to occur, making Deep Water Cove a true little New Zealand paradise.
